Lithospermum ruderale

Columbia Gromwell, Columbia Puccoon
Other regional names: Lemonweed +5 more
  • Lemonweed
  • Wayside Gromwell
  • Western Puccoon
  • Western Stoneseed
  • Whiteweed
  • Woolly Puccoon
Also known as: Batschia pilosa G.Don +6 more
  • Batschia pilosa G.Don
  • Batschia torreyi (Nutt.) G.Don
  • Lithospermum lanceolatum Rydb.
  • Lithospermum ruderale var. lanceolatum A.Nelson
  • Lithospermum ruderale var. macrospermum J.F.Macbr.
  • Lithospermum ruderale var. torreyi J.F.Macbr.
  • Lithospermum torreyi Nutt.
Botanical Data
  • Taxonomic Rank: Species
  • Botanical Family: Boraginaceae
  • WCVP Morphological Data: Recorded natively as a perennial.

Found natively in North America, Lithospermum ruderale (commonly known as Columbia gromwell or Columbia puccoon) is a herbaceous perennial belonging to the Boraginaceae family. Within its native range, this species is primarily associated with temperate conditions.

Macro Climate
Temperate
Plant Type
Herbaceous Perennial

Native Range

Continents (WGSRPD)
NORTHERN AMERICA
Regions (WGSRPD)
Northwestern U.S.A., Southwestern U.S.A., Western Canada
Botanical Countries (WGSRPD L3)
Alberta, British Columbia, California, Colorado, Idaho, Montana, Nevada, Oregon, Saskatchewan, Utah, Washington, Wyoming
